This South Carolina note printed on thick brown paper by Peter Timothy in Charleston. The front features an emblem of a horse encircled by the Latin motto “DOMINUM GENEROSA RECUSAT” (The well born refuses a master). The back is ornamented with Hebrew and Greek letters, with “Death to Counterfeit” appearing twice. Solid example of this desirable 1776 note with bold ink and large margins.
